Shows vary from year -to-year, last show was a bust, as making booth fee doesn't cover supplies and travel expenses! The one the year before wasn't as bad but only because of a custom pick-up order! so looking for a new one for that time slot next year! (and this was a juried show too with a prime end space)
On the other hand I entered into a couple of juried shows in a different town, sales weren't bad and on my last one there we had some return customers looking for us. It takes a couple of shows in the same town to build a following.
Our next show is a new one for us too and a small space (I really like the outside shows since they are usually at least two days with more room-but not this time of year with the cold!) Then 2 more (repeat) in Nov. and we are done for the year! By January it's time to set next year's schedule!
